feat(ecs): suspending component DSL
read / readOrNull / modify primitives that take an EntityHandle, switch to the entity's world dispatcher, run the block on the world thread, and return to the caller's dispatcher. ComponentRegistry maps KClass to opaque ComponentType keys for O(1) hot-path lookup.

## Mutate-in-place
|
||||
|
||||
Hytale's `Store` exposes no public `setComponent(ref, value)`. The component
|
||||
returned by `getComponent` is the live in-store instance — mutating it is
|
||||
the persistence step. There's no copy and no rollback. If a `modify` block
|
||||
throws after a partial mutation, the partial state stays.
|
||||
|
||||
The practical rule: validate first, mutate second. Don't treat `modify` as a
|
||||
transaction; treat it as "best-effort atomic chunk on the world thread".
